Bone Health – Arthritis and Osteoporosis

When it comes to the bone health issues such as Osteoporosis and Arthritis, there often can be the assumption that both of these conditions are similar bone problems, but this is far from being true. These are both bone diseases that needs further explaining, so that there is a better understanding of the both of these bone diseases for better bone health.

The data available on the specific bone disease of Osteoporosis, on the average at least 44 million individuals within the United States alone are known to have some form of Osteoporosis and more than 68% of these unfortunate individuals are women. Osteoporosis is a bone disease which attacks the tissue directly and leads to bone tissue loss. It causes the bones to lose the calcium density that normally protects us from bone fractures and breaks.

Health Issues for Master Cleanse Diet

It’s important you are aware of the health issues for Master Cleanse diet if you’re serious about giving it a go. Like any diet, you need to be aware of what could happen to you and your body, along with the side effects. It’s not just detox diets that have side effects; just about any diet that restricts calorie intake will have side effects and health issues. I would suggest that before embarking on the Master Cleanse that you do as much research as you can to make sure you are fully informed, this way you can weigh up the pros and cons for yourself.

Nutrition experts warn there are possible risks from extended or regular fasts of any kind. Things like vitamin deficiencies, blood sugar level problems and muscle break down. If you deprive your body of the vitamins and minerals we get from eating solid foods, something that is not allowed on most detox diets, you can actually weaken your body’s ability to fight infection.
